Real-World Examples of Drive Coupling Applications in Industrial Machinery

Drive couplings play a vital role in various industrial machinery and equipment, enabling efficient power transmission and motion control. Here are some real-world examples of drive coupling applications:

  • Pumps: Drive couplings are commonly used in pump systems to transmit power from electric motors or engines to the pump impeller. They ensure a smooth and reliable transfer of rotational motion, allowing the pump to move fluids in applications such as water supply, irrigation, wastewater treatment, and chemical processing.
  • Compressors: Compressors often utilize drive couplings to connect the motor or engine shaft to the compressor’s crankshaft. This coupling arrangement enables the conversion of rotational energy into pressure, making compressors essential in various industries like refrigeration, air conditioning, and gas processing.
  • Fans and Blowers: Drive couplings are employed in fans and blowers to transfer power from the driving motor to the fan or blower impeller. These couplings help control the speed and airflow, finding applications in HVAC systems, industrial ventilation, and air pollution control.
  • Conveyor Systems: Conveyor belts and systems use drive couplings to transmit power to the conveyor’s rollers or pulleys, allowing for the movement of materials in industries like mining, manufacturing, and logistics.
  • Mixers and Agitators: In mixers and agitators, drive couplings connect the motor or gearbox to the mixing shaft, ensuring efficient blending and agitation of liquids and granular materials in chemical processing, food production, and pharmaceutical manufacturing.
  • Machine Tools: Drive couplings are essential components in machine tools, connecting the motor to the spindle or lead screw. This enables precise and controlled movement in machining operations like milling, turning, and drilling.
  • Paper and Textile Machinery: Paper and textile manufacturing machinery often use drive couplings to transmit power in various stages of the production process, such as rolling, cutting, and winding.
  • Material Handling Equipment: Material handling equipment, such as forklifts, cranes, and hoists, rely on drive couplings to transfer power from the engine or electric motor to the wheels or lifting mechanisms.

These are just a few examples of the wide-ranging applications of drive couplings across different industries. Their versatility and ability to accommodate various load conditions make them essential components in a diverse array of industrial machinery, enhancing efficiency and reliability in power transmission and motion control systems.

Is it Possible to Replace a Drive Coupling Without Professional Help?

Replacing a drive coupling without professional help is possible in some cases, but it is not recommended for everyone. The complexity of the task and the level of expertise required depend on the specific coupling type, the application, and the individual’s mechanical skills. Here are some considerations:

  • Simple Couplings: Some drive couplings are relatively simple and may be easy to replace, especially if they are accessible and don’t require specialized tools or equipment.
  • Mechanical Aptitude: Individuals with a good understanding of mechanical systems, tools, and procedures may feel more confident in attempting to replace a drive coupling on their own.
  • Manufacturer’s Instructions: If the manufacturer provides detailed instructions for coupling replacement, individuals with mechanical knowledge may be able to follow the steps and perform the replacement.
  • Risk of Damage: Incorrect installation of the coupling can lead to damage, misalignment, or premature failure. If unsure about the procedure, it is best to seek professional assistance to avoid costly mistakes.
  • Specialized Couplings: Some drive couplings, especially those used in complex industrial applications, may require specialized knowledge and tools for replacement.
  • Safety Concerns: Working with rotating machinery can be hazardous. If not properly handled, injuries can occur. Professional technicians are trained to handle such tasks safely.
  • Warranty and Liability: Attempting a DIY replacement may void any warranty on the coupling. Additionally, if the replacement causes damage or accidents, it could lead to liability issues.

If you have doubts about your ability to replace the drive coupling correctly or if it requires specialized knowledge and equipment, it is best to seek professional help. Experienced technicians have the expertise and tools to perform the replacement safely and efficiently, ensuring the proper functioning of the power transmission system.

For those with the necessary skills and experience, following the manufacturer’s instructions and safety guidelines is essential when attempting to replace a drive coupling on their own.

How to Diagnose and Fix Common Problems with Drive Couplings?

Drive couplings, like any mechanical component, can experience issues over time. Diagnosing and fixing these problems promptly is essential to ensure the proper functioning of the power transmission system and prevent further damage. Here’s a step-by-step guide to diagnose and fix common problems with drive couplings:

  1. Visual Inspection: Start by visually inspecting the drive coupling and surrounding components. Look for signs of wear, cracks, or damage in the coupling’s flexible elements, bolts, and connections.
  2. Check for Misalignment: Misalignment is a common cause of drive coupling problems. Use alignment tools to check if the shafts connected by the coupling are properly aligned. Misalignment can lead to premature wear and vibration issues.
  3. Listen for Unusual Noises: Unusual noises like clunking, rattling, or grinding may indicate problems with the drive coupling. Pay attention to any sounds while the vehicle is in motion.
  4. Inspect for Fluid Leaks: Check for any transmission fluid leaks around the drive coupling area. Fluid leaks can lead to insufficient lubrication and cause further damage.
  5. Test for Slippage: Slippage can occur if the drive coupling is not securely transmitting power. Perform tests to see if the transmission slips out of gear or has difficulty engaging.
  6. Monitor Power Loss: If the vehicle experiences power loss or reduced acceleration, it may be due to a faulty drive coupling. Monitor the engine’s performance and power delivery.
  7. Inspect Bolts and Fasteners: Loose or worn bolts and fasteners can lead to coupling problems. Check and tighten all connections as needed.
  8. Examine Torsional Flexibility: For flexible drive couplings, assess the torsional flexibility to ensure it can accommodate torque fluctuations and prevent damage from torque spikes.
  9. Replace Damaged Coupling: If you find any issues with the drive coupling during inspection, replace the damaged coupling with a new one that matches the required specifications.
  10. Realign Shafts: If misalignment is detected, realign the shafts to the manufacturer’s recommended tolerances. Proper alignment will help prevent future problems.
  11. Lubricate as Needed: Some drive couplings require periodic lubrication. Ensure that the coupling is adequately lubricated as per the manufacturer’s guidelines.
  12. Perform Test Runs: After fixing the drive coupling or making adjustments, perform test runs to ensure that the transmission functions smoothly and there are no unusual noises or vibrations.

It’s essential to follow the manufacturer’s guidelines and maintenance schedules for the specific drive coupling used in your vehicle. Regular maintenance and inspections can help identify and address potential problems early, preventing costly repairs and ensuring the longevity of the power transmission system.
